## Session Handling for Health Checks

The Corvel gateway sits behind the Lanternside load balancer, which probes /healthz every ten seconds. Health-check requests are stateless by design: they bypass the session store entirely so that probe traffic never inflates session counts or evicts real user sessions. New team members should note that the deep-check endpoint, /healthz/deep, does verify session-store connectivity and therefore requires authentication. When probing it manually, supply the token below.

bearer token for tajep-kajef: eyJhbGciOiJIUzI1NiIsInR5cCI6IkpXVCJ9.eyJzdWIiOiIoOsZ23In0.CsygO0hs

## Onboarding: Digest Scheduler (Wrenfold)

New folks: the batch email digest scheduler runs hourly and groups notifications per workspace. Scheduling windows live in the `digest-plan` table; never edit them directly in production. If the scheduler account gets locked after a failed migration, use the recovery CLI from the ops bastion, pick the most recent good plan snapshot, and confirm with your sync lead. The final restore prompt requires the passphrase noted below.

unlock words, fafop-hawep: briwyn-oliix-sorox

Action item: The Relayn deploy-status bot silently dropped updates when the pipeline API paginated results, so responders believed a rollback had completed when it had not. We will add pagination handling, a staleness banner, and an integration test. Until merged, verify deploy state directly in the pipeline console, documented at the page below.

runbook for kahop-kajop: https://rundeck.ordinio.test/display/secrets/pipeline/issue/pages/repo/browse/e5732776e07d1285107e5aeb

# Break-Glass: Catalog Cache Invalidation

Scope: the Pinrow product catalog at Veldstone Retail. If stale prices persist after a purge and the Hollowmere invalidation queue is wedged, use break-glass to flush the edge tier directly. Contractors: get verbal sign-off from the catalog lead first. Steps: open the Hollowmere admin shell, select emergency-flush, confirm the tenant, and run it once — repeated flushes thrash the origin. Access is logged and expires after 20 minutes. Unseal the admin shell with the passphrase below.

recovery phrase for kahop-tajog: istix-casvan